Ok this is kinda a redo of my previous post. I apologize for my anger, but I hate when Skyrim does this to me. I could use some help please, any suggestions read below for information.

 

 

 

 

As said in my earlier post, I was playing Skyrim just fine when I reset in the launcher to set my game graphics to default.

It chose high by default and I went in game to experience some severe lag. I also noticed a texture increase in my character

his head wasn't as smooth, had more pixels, and so did the floor. I didn't install any texture replacer mods recently, so I don't

understand how resetting my graphics to high could increase the graphics when they were on high to begin with, just some minor tweaks

to increase distance view.

look at the Stitching on the right shoulder, it has more definition....my guess....IT was on Medium , and is now on High. OR it Was on High and is now on ultra.

 

Either way no way both settings are the same, Could be the detail setting was the same and one had AA off and the other has AA/AF on?. 

 

Looks better now any way ...lol

 

Center of lower Pic, on the hill . see the thing (silver) it is not in the upper PIC, The Object slider is a different setting.  Distance object fade? forget, been a long time since i opened the launcher settings.

You could just set the textures down to medium. You might get the same effect as your old 'high' textures.
